Our overall score for South Bents is 55/100, built from 9 categories. Its biggest lead over the typical UK town is transport: 70/100 against a national town median of 21/100. Furthest below the national norm is safety, at 14/100 against a town median of 88/100.
Among the 4 scored places sharing the SR6 postcode district, South Bents ranks 3rd. Against the wider SR6 district average of 65/100, that is 10 points below. On transport specifically, South Bents sits 10 points below the SR6 district figure of 80/100. Wider context for the surrounding area: SR6 postcode district.

How safe is South Bents?
Crime levels in South Bents are high relative to the national average. Our safety score is 14/100. There were 273 crimes recorded in the area over the past 12 months.
What are the best schools in South Bents?
Among the top-rated schools in South Bents are Fulwell Junior School, Monkwearmouth Academy and Seaburn Dene Primary School, rated Outstanding by Ofsted. There are 5 rated schools in South Bents in total.
What are house prices like in South Bents?
The current median house price in South Bents is £398,475, around 40% above the England and Wales average. Over the past five years, prices have fallen by around 2%.
